Tom wrote: > > On Tue, 9 Sep 1997, Edwin Culp wrote: > > > Edwin Culp wrote: > > FreeBSD RELEG_2_2 > > Squid 1.1.15 > > pentium 133Mh > > 128M Ram with 32M for squid > > 1.8G divided in two disks, different controlers eide. > > >7,000 connections per hour. > > > > Worked fine at 3,500 Connections and release 2.2.2 > > I upgraded with cvsup and supprise. I'm recompiling > > my kernel just in case. > > > > It can't even finish reading the cache before dying:-( > > Anyone else seen this? > > > > Thanks > > > > Ed > > > > Is the userid that Squid is running at able to allocate 32MB of RAM? Do > a: > > su squid (to change to the squid uid) > > csh -c limit (to display limits for squid uid) > > Tom That was it. I just updated the login.conf file and everything seems to be o.k.
